Nicholas:

On this page:
http://maven.apache.org/maven-1.x/reference/properties.html

About halfway down you'll see "proxy properties", which should allow you
to set up Maven to go through a proxy - this will get you access to the
object code. I believe Steve just posted a link to a source mirror as
well, for the source.

HTH!

Mike
